The Saints and the Beauty of Holiness

It’s easy to look at the saints as paragons of virtue and holiness, and forget that they were real people who faced real struggle, temptation, and doubt. Fr. Thomas Dubay wrote extensively on the saints as examples of everyday holiness. We look back on a conversation with him today.

Fr Thomas Dubay was a priest, author and retreat director who wrote more than 20 books on Catholic spirituality, in which he emphasized the importance of renewed conversion and contemplative prayer. He led retreats for religious communities all over the world and was a frequent guest on Mother Angelica Live. His books included “Deep Conversion, Deep Prayer,” “Saints: A Closer Look” and “Seeking Spiritual Direction: How to Grow the Divine Life Within.” He died in 2010 at age 88.
